Deputies report the arrest of a Palmyra woman following an assault investigation in Sodus.
According to a news release Alixieandra Hinkle, 28, is accused of grabbing a woman, threatening her, and striking her in the face resulting in several injuries in front of a residence on Route 104.
As result, Hinkle was charged with assault, criminal mischief, and harassment. She was taken into custody a little before 7 p.m. on Sunday.
She was transported to the Wayne County Jail for processing and will answer the charges at a later date.
